My Buying Guides on Inflatable Buster Collars For Dogs

Why I Consider an Inflatable Buster Collar

When I look for a recovery collar for my dog, I want something that helps protect wounds or surgical sites without making my dog miserable. An inflatable buster collar is often a good choice because it is softer than a traditional cone, easier for my dog to move around in, and usually more comfortable for eating, sleeping, and relaxing.

What I Check for First

Before I buy one, I make sure the collar is actually suitable for my dog’s recovery needs. If my dog can still reach the injured area, then the collar is not doing its job. I also think about whether the collar is meant for neck injuries, post-surgery recovery, or preventing licking and biting.

Size and Fit Matter Most

I always measure my dog’s neck carefully before ordering. A collar that is too loose can slip off or fail to block access to the wound, while one that is too tight can be uncomfortable. I look for a product with a clear sizing chart and adjustable closure so I can get a secure fit. If my dog is between sizes, I usually compare the neck measurements and choose the option that gives the safest fit.

Comfort for My Dog

I prefer a collar with a soft outer material because my dog is more likely to tolerate it. I also pay attention to whether the collar is lightweight and whether it allows my dog to lie down comfortably. If my dog seems stressed or keeps trying to remove it, I know comfort is just as important as protection.

Durability and Material Quality

I want a collar that can handle daily use without leaking or tearing. Strong stitching, puncture-resistant material, and a reliable inflatable bladder are important to me. If my dog is active or tends to scratch, I look for extra durability so I do not have to replace the collar too soon.

Ease of Inflation and Cleaning

I like collars that are easy to inflate and deflate, especially if I need to adjust them quickly. A secure valve is important so air does not leak out. I also prefer a collar with a removable or wipeable cover because accidents happen, and I want something I can keep clean without much effort.

Visibility and Movement

One thing I appreciate about inflatable buster collars is that they usually let my dog see better than a hard plastic cone. That means my dog can move around the house with less frustration. Still, I make sure the collar is large enough to stop licking while not blocking vision or movement more than necessary.

When I Would Not Choose One

I do not rely on an inflatable buster collar if my dog can bend far enough to reach the wound. In those cases, I would choose a more secure option, such as a traditional cone or another vet-approved recovery device. I always think about the specific injury first, not just comfort.

My Final Buying Tip

If I am choosing an inflatable buster collar, I focus on three things: proper fit, reliable protection, and comfort. When those three line up, I feel much better about my dog’s recovery. I also like to check with my vet if I am unsure, because the best collar is the one that keeps my dog safe and helps healing happen smoothly.
